1 条题解

  • 0
    @ 2024-4-24 16:03:17

    source:CF1936B

    我们考虑它到底是从哪边出去的,其实跟左边的>>以及右边的<<有关,假设左边有44>>,右边有66<<,那么他显然从左边出去,并且路径一定是走到第一个>>,向右走到第一个<<,然后向左走到第二个>>,如此进行。

    那么答案就是个前缀和,我们二分或者用其他办法找到对应的位置,前缀和一下即可。

    • 1

    信息

    ID
    1410
    时间
    2000ms
    内存
    512MiB
    难度
    10
    标签
    (无)
    递交数
    125
    已通过
    4
    上传者